Diego Alexandre Calazans

Desenvolvedor na linguagem Java há mais de 4 anos. Possui conhecimentos dos padrões Core JEE, bem como sólidos conhecimentos em métodos de orientação a objetos. Já trabalhou com diversos frameworks Java, onde adquiriu vasta experiência em Struts 2, JPA/Hibernate, EJB3, Spring, Maven, ambientes de integração contínua (CI), Jboss, Tomcat.

Informações coletadas do Lattes em 14/11/2022

Acadêmico

Formação acadêmica

Especialização em Engenharia de Software

2007 - 2009

FACULDADE DE CIÊNCIAS E TECNOLOGIA DE UNAÍ

Graduação em Sistema de Informação

2005 - 2008

FACULDADE DE CIÊNCIAS E TECNOLOGIA DE UNAÍ
Orientador: Clênio Marcos Mendes

Ensino Médio (2º grau)

2003 - 2004

Escola Estadual Virgílo de Melo Franco

Ensino Médio (2º grau)

2002 - 2002

Colégio Cenecista Nossa Senhora do Carmo

Ensino Fundamental (1º grau)

1994 - 2001

Escola Estadual Teófilo Martins Ferreira

Idiomas

Bandeira representando o idioma Inglês

Lê Razoavelmente.

Bandeira representando o idioma Português

Compreende Bem, Fala Bem, Lê Bem, Escreve Razoavelmente.

Áreas de atuação

Grande área: Ciências Exatas e da Terra / Área: Ciência da Computação / Subárea: Sistemas de Computação/Especialidade: Arquitetura de Sistemas de Computação.

Grande área: Ciências Exatas e da Terra / Área: Ciência da Computação / Subárea: Metodologia e Técnicas da Computação/Especialidade: Banco de Dados.

Grande área: Ciências Exatas e da Terra / Área: Ciência da Computação / Subárea: Metodologia e Técnicas da Computação/Especialidade: Engenharia de Software.

Grande área: Ciências Exatas e da Terra / Área: Ciência da Computação / Subárea: Metodologia e Técnicas da Computação/Especialidade: Linguagens de Programação.

Grande área: Ciências Exatas e da Terra / Área: Ciência da Computação / Subárea: Metodologia e Técnicas da Computação/Especialidade: Sistemas de Informação.

Histórico profissional

Experiência profissional

2012 - Atual

Grupo Infinita

Vínculo: Celetista, Enquadramento Funcional: Arquiteto de Software Java - Consultor, Carga horária: 15

Outras informações:
Responsável pela definição e manutenção da arquitetura de softwares, integrações; Instalação, configuração e manutenção de servidores Jboss; Instalação, configuração e manutenção de ambientes de SCM (SVN, Trac, Continuum, Archiva, Maven); EJB3, Spring, Spring Security, JPA/Hibernate, Struts 2, Tiles, DWR, Jboss 7, Nginx, Web-Services; Certificados Digitais Ambiente Linux (Ubuntu Desktop, Ubuntu Server)

2011 - Atual

NT Soluções

Vínculo: Celetista, Enquadramento Funcional: Arquiteto de Software Java, Carga horária: 40, Regime: Dedicação exclusiva.

Outras informações:
Responsável pela definição e manutenção da arquitetura de softwares, integrações; Instalação, configuração e manutenção de servidores Jboss; Instalação, configuração e manutenção de ambientes de SCM (SVN, Jiira, Continuum, Archiva, Maven); EJB3, Spring, JPA/Hibernate, Struts 1, Struts 2, Tiles, DWR, Tomcat, Jboss 4, Nginx, Web-Services, jUnit; Ambiente Linux (Ubuntu Desktop, Debian Server), Shell Script; Auxílio aos desenvolvedores da equipe;

2009 - 2011

CTIS Tecnologia S.A

Vínculo: Celetista, Enquadramento Funcional: Analista/Desenvolvedor, Carga horária: 40, Regime: Dedicação exclusiva.

Outras informações:
- Analista e desenvolvedor JEE, utilizando EJB3, JPA/Hibernate, Struts2, Tiles2, JSF/RichFaces, Facelets, Spring, JBoss, WebServices, Oracle/PL-SQL.

2008 - 2009

Poliedro Informática Consultoria e Serviços

Vínculo: Celetista, Enquadramento Funcional: Analista/Desenvolvedor, Carga horária: 40, Regime: Dedicação exclusiva.

Outras informações:
- Participação em projetos de pequeno e médio porte para ambiente Web, desenvolvidos com tecnologias Java, como JSP, Servlets, Hibernate, Struts2, AJAX-DWR, iReport, dentre outras. - Responsável pela definição da arquitetura de softwares - Líder de equipe em fases de implementação e testes

2006 - 2008

Softsystem Engenharia em Software

Vínculo: Celetista, Enquadramento Funcional: Analista/Desenvolvedor, Carga horária: 40, Regime: Dedicação exclusiva.

Outras informações:
Participação em projetos de pequeno, médio e grande porte Client-Server, com tecnologias Microsoft .Net (.Net Remoting, Windows Forms, NHibernate, componentes DevExpress, linguagens como: C# e Object Pascal) e Java (JSP, Servlets, Hibernate, Struts2), modelador de dados.